ECC vs. Non-ECC RAM: What Workstation Users Actually Need to Know
ECC (Error-Correcting Code) RAM detects and corrects single-bit memory errors on the fly. For most home and prosumer workstations, non-ECC RAM is perfectly fine. But if you're in a field where data integrity is non-negotiable โ think financial modeling, scientific computing, medical imaging, or server-adjacent workloads โ ECC is worth the premium and the platform requirements that come with it.
Who Should Use ECC RAM
- Server and workstation builds on AMD EPYC, Threadripper PRO, or Intel Xeon platforms
- Professionals running 24/7 compute workloads where silent data corruption is a real risk
- Virtualization hosts running multiple critical VMs
- Database administrators and developers working with sensitive data
Who Can Skip ECC
- Content creators, video editors, and 3D artists on mainstream platforms
- Developers and engineers on AMD Ryzen or Intel Core systems
- Power users who want maximum performance per dollar
For most people reading this, a high-capacity non-ECC DDR5 or DDR4 kit will be the right call. ECC typically requires a workstation-class motherboard and a CPU that supports it โ not a given on consumer platforms.
How Much RAM Does a Workstation Actually Need?
The honest answer: more than you think. Here's a practical breakdown:
- 32GB: Solid for general productivity, moderate video editing (1080pโ4K), software development, and light virtualization.
- 64GB: The sweet spot for serious workstations in 2026. Handles 4Kโ8K editing, large VM setups, heavy multitasking, and complex 3D scenes comfortably.
- 128GB+: Reserved for heavy data science, deep learning training rigs, broadcast-level video work, and enterprise virtualization.
If you're unsure, start at 64GB and leave room to expand. Running out of RAM mid-project is far more painful than slightly overspending upfront.

Best DDR4 Workstation RAM: Corsair Vengeance LPX DDR4-3600 32GB
Not everyone is on a DDR5 platform, and DDR4 still makes a strong case for value-focused workstation builds in 2026. The Corsair Vengeance LPX DDR4-3600 32GB runs approximately ~$220 (~$6.87/GB), making it a significantly cheaper path to high-capacity RAM.
DDR4-3600 hits the sweet spot for AMD Ryzen systems in particular, aligning well with the memory controller's preferred frequency for maximum performance. If your platform supports DDR4, this is a proven, stable choice for productivity workloads.
